Step back in time with this print of a barber in Istanbul from 1896. The engraving by Leon Joseph Florentin Bonnat beautifully captures the essence of Turkish culture and tradition during that era.
The image depicts a skilled barber meticulously attending to his client's beard and hair, showcasing the intricate artistry and precision involved in grooming practices of the time. The attention to detail is evident in every stroke of the razor, highlighting the barber's expertise and dedication to his craft.
As you gaze at this historical snapshot, you can almost feel yourself transported to bustling streets of Istanbul, surrounded by the sights and sounds of daily life in late 19th century Turkey. The ornate decor of the barbershop adds an air of sophistication and elegance to the scene, reflecting the cultural richness and diversity of Istanbul.
